What is self-recording?
In 2008–2010, GPs are able to accrue a maximum of 20 CPD points towards their total requirement for the triennium for participating in educational activities not formally accredited by the QA&CPD Program. Participation in unaccredited activities is optional. General practitioners who choose to participate in unaccredited activities need to self record their participation and notify the QA&CPD Program when they have accrued the maximum allowable number of points.
